She is a Doctor in sociology. Since 1992, she has been a lecturer at the IEE (European studies institute of the University of Paris8) on the following subjects : arts and cultural sociology, cultural practices and policies in Europe. In 1997, she became the publishing director of the journal Culture Europe, founded in 1994 by Jean-Michel Djian. This publication has specialised on the issues related to cultural pratices and policies in Europe, and is run by European specialists on the related matters.
She is also works as an expert for the European Commission, the European Foundation for Culture, the French Foreign office, and the AFAA (French Association for the artistic action). She is a literature translator of Albanian.
